What is Cobol Computer Programming and why does it matter?

Cobol computer programming has been around for over six decades, and its legacy codebase has grown to become a significant challenge for many organizations. With the rise of digital transformation, companies are under pressure to modernize their systems, improve efficiency, and reduce costs. However, Cobol Computer Programming presents a unique set of challenges, including complex codebases, outdated technology, and a lack of skilled resources.
